Introduction 2.2 Package Contents Laser head In order to provide the best beam quality only high quality optical components are used within the laser head. A thermoelectric cooler is integrated for stabilizing the temperature. Laser controller The laser controller includes three status indicators, a USB interface, a modulation mode switch and a key switch with a 5 second delay.
NovaPro User Manual Installation and Operation 3.1 Precautions • Take care of all laser safety instructions as described in chapter 1. Always wear laser protection glasses for the specified wavelength range. • Consider regulations for Electrostatic Discharge (ESD). • Do not open the laser head. Opening the case voids the warranty and may cause uncontrolled laser radiation.

Installation and Operation 3.4 Operation modes You can select the operation mode using Ltune or your own custom software. In stand- alone operation without a computer, the modulation mode can be selected using the switch on the controller. The technical specifications for the modulation inputs can be found in chapter 5.

Computer Control Computer Control The NovaPro series includes a USB interface for remote control. The laser can be controlled with • The Windows application software Ltune (included), • the cable remote control RC-1 (available separately) or • Custom user software via serial communication.
NovaPro User Manual To install the software, simply run the setup file from the CD-ROM included in the package. The setup package then installs the application software and the device driver. For the operating system to properly recognize the device, it’s best if you install the software first before attaching the device.

Optional system configurations Optional system configurations Fiber coupler Each NovaPro laser system can be equipped with a fiber coupler. Water cooling system For operation in extreme conditions, there is a optional water cooling system for the bottom plate. This ensures an optimal heat dissipation. Round beam Circular and other beam shape characteristics are available on request.
